Episode VII Rumor: Full-Size Millennium Falcon Built, Waiting To Move To Pinewood
Yahoo Movies UK is reporting some very interesting news about the most famous spaceship in the galaxy:
According to a source close to production, the iconic Millennium Falcon has already been built for 'Star Wars: Episode VII'… and it could be bigger than ever.Ryan Leston over at Yahoo wonders why the filmmakers would build a life-size set when they could just recreate the ship digitally, but then he suggests that the Falcon prop might be used at a Disney theme park at some point in the future. "We already know that Disney has big 'Star Wars' plans for their numerous theme parks," he writes. "But could the Millennium Falcon be the centre piece?" That would certainly gel with one persistent rumor we're hearing for Disneyland.
"A full-scale 1:1 Millennium Falcon has been built as well as the interiors of the ship for filming," they explained. "The Falcon is done - inside and out. The sets were built off-site, ready to move when Lucasfilm/Bad Robot were ready to move into Pinewood [Studios in Buckinghamshire, UK]."
